Jun 18, 2021 · Ans.: Magnetic exercise bikes generate resistance with the help of magnets. When the flywheel revolves, it goes through two magnets. To increase or decrease the resistance, the magnets shift closer to or further away from the flywheel. On the other hand, friction-based bikes utilize felt pads located on the flywheel. To buy, magnetic spin bikes are a little more expensive but to maintain, friction spin bikes are more expensive. It's because magnetic resistance indoor bikes doesn't require maintenance or brake pads every year while friction resistance indoor bikes need new brake pads every couple of years. To sum up, the main difference between an Air Bike, like Airdyne, and a Spin Bike is the handlebars and the type of resistance. Air Bikes, in contrast with Spin Bikes, can provide you with a full-body workout by using independent handlebars that move forward and back. Finally, an Air Bike creates resistance with a large fan while a Spin Bike is built around a flywheel mechanism with a friction or (usually) magnetic belt drive resistance. Bike Wheel. Air Bike: The first difference that one notices in an air bike is the large wheel. This wheel is quite similar to a fan and has blades that displace air as you pedal. This creates infinite resistance in a fan bike. Spin Bike: The front wheel on a spin bike is much smaller and is called a flywheel.

Jan 21, 2020 · Air Resistance. Air bikes have a fan rather than a flywheel. While both magnetic and contact resistance cycle bikes create resistance by applying pressure to the flywheel, air bikes create resistance as the fan blades push against the air. The faster you ride, the more resistance you’ll feel. If you’re interested in HIIT or Tabata training.
